Research finds ways to address effects of climate change in agricultural production in Nepal

Tuesday, October 25, 2016 - 09:01 in Earth & Climate

Nepal is one of the most vulnerable countries in terms of climate change and its impacts. Rising average temperature, delayed monsoon, reduction in the number of rain days but increased intensity of rain are some of the climatic phenomena observed in the recent years. Mountainous and hilly regions are more affected by the changing weather patterns.
